STELLAR BEANS coffee house & edibles - Lake Charles, LA Vibes: ⭐️⭐️⭐️⭐️⭐️ - very much a local, artsy hangout. There are welcoming regulars of all shapes & sizes. Plenty of art displayed & for sale including paintings, cups, etc. Large menu with Star Wars themed drinks, as well as really delicious sandwiches. Open on Sundays which is not a norm for a locally owned shop. I always visit on my way to brunch. There was also local jazz music being played today. Drinks: ⭐️⭐️⭐️⭐️ - strong coffee flavor & the syrups don’t taste artificial at all. Lots of options. I love the snickerdoodle with cold foam 🥰 Accessibility: ⭐️⭐️⭐️ - parking is a wheelchair users nightmare 😵‍💫 all of downtown lake Charles needs a little cement refresh. A few spots directly up front, parallel parking. There is also a one way alley close by with zero handicapped spots. There is also an extremely deep crevice in the alley that NEEDS to be fixed (not stellar beans fault). The front doors are double but one stays locked so it’s a tight squeeze. Once inside, it’s very roomy with low top tables & couches. Where the coffee is served is (estimated) 5ft from the ground so that is not accessible for a wheelchair user. Restroom is single with correctly placed grab bars.

Visited from Texas for a mini get away and fell in love with this spot! I got a Java the Hut latte and it took me by surprise. The cutie with the half white half black hair, mentioned that the owner’s favorite flavor was the one I ordered and I can see why! It was sooooo delicious I had to go back the next day for another one. I ordered one of the egg stacks which was awesome that they have keto/paleo options. It’s hard to come across places that offer a breakfast item that’s friendly to my dietary restrictions. I couldn’t help myself and also tried the BLT with brie and grapes, the next day and wow! I was happy to had use my cheat meal for that sandwich. They even spelled my name correctly which is uncommon. Very sweet owners and pleasant staff! Loved the trinket basket; leave one take one! Never seen that anywhere else either. Can’t forget to mention that it’s been over a month since I visited this place and the beautiful little spotted plant I bought has now grown 3 new leaves. It’s a spotted Begonia and pothos in one!

Spent the night in Lake Charles and was looking for a good coffee spot next morning. Mission accomplished. I absolutely loved this place, combining my favorite genre of space themed movies and TV shows (Trekkie and Star Wars fan), and good coffee, food and atmosphere. My cold brew was outstanding, smooth with notes of chocolate. I had Bacon, Eggs, Sausage and cheese minus the bread. It was awesome and filling. My GF had the Interstellar Cristo and she raved about how good it was. The staff were two young ladies and they were friendly and amazing. There was an awesome atmosphere with plenty of space to sit and enjoy your beverage and food orders. Come out and support local businesses and avoid chains. I highly recommend this place!
